Road-legal mobility scooters, or class 3 mobility scooter 3 scooters, are the most well-known models on the Motability scheme and are ideal for those who need a longer range, more efficient and comfortable scooters for regular use. They are compliant with British government requirements and can be driven on roads, bus lanes, or 'cycle-only' lanes however, it is not recommended to drive them on unrestricted dual carriageways.

They're usually driven at a maximum speed of eight mph, so they're safe to drive on the road. They feature front and rear lights and reflectors as well as direction indicators along with a horn and rear view mirrors, along with a sturdy braking system. They are also equipped with tyres ranging from 13 to 14 inches wide, which allows them to easily withstand the demands of the road. They're suitable for pedestrians as well as other road users, such as cyclists.
